Low-temperature (NH4)2SO4 roasting for sustainable recovery of aluminum and iron from coal gangue: process optimization and mechanism insight

The increasing global demand for aluminum (Al) and iron (Fe), along with the rapid depletion of high-grade ores, presents a critical challenge, driving the urgent search for alternative resources. Coal gangue is an abundant solid waste from coal mining which emerges as a compelling secondary resource due to its high Al and Fe content. In this study, we report a green and efficient process for the recovery of Al and Fe from coal gangue, featuring (NH4)2SO4-assisted low-temperature roasting and subsequent water leaching. We systematically investigated the influence of key parameters and achieved optimal leaching efficiencies of 80.58 ± 1.99% for Al and 90.72 ± 1.55% for Fe. Mechanistic analysis revealed that the roasting process effectively disrupted the stable mineral matrix, converting Al and Fe into highly water-soluble sulfates (NH4Al(SO4)2 and Fe2(SO4)3). Notably, this method immobilized sulfur as environmentally benign CaSO4 and MgSO4, thereby preventing SO2 emissions. This acid-free, low-temperature method provides a sustainable and affordable way to turn coal gangue into valuable metals, thereby supporting a circular economy and reducing the environmental impact of the coal industry.
